Transaction 80e771b7fcfbcbdbe815faf6e46ed29a61ab1811484806271bf8b3a4a47c0f9e

1 Input
2 Outputs
  • 80e771b7fcfbcbdbe815faf6e46ed29a61ab1811484806271bf8b3a4a47c0f9e:0
  • value  26302500
    address  3DKW8KmJA6A88VaoepFykDuEmVaoW9ADbc
  • 80e771b7fcfbcbdbe815faf6e46ed29a61ab1811484806271bf8b3a4a47c0f9e:1
  • value  78902957
    address  18DFvtiMXesvw7Sh3SMDgkXN7ssx8bWW6u